Does Makers Mark really hand-dipped every bottle?

The red wax on the bottles is every bit as recognizable as the Maker’s Mark® name. Every bottle is still hand-dipped today, and when you visit the distillery, you can dip your own.

What is the best time of year to do the Bourbon Trail?

Spring
Spring is a nice time to visit the Kentucky Bourbon Trail. The weather is pleasant and bourbon is in full production. If you want to tour the distilleries without the crowds, visit Kentucky from the end of November through March.

The Maker’s Mark Distillery in Loretto, Ky., is a National Historic Landmark. What is Maker’s Mark?

Maker’s Mark is the legacy of a family whose whisky-making saga spans several generations. Members of the Samuels family have become icons and even Kentucky Bourbon Hall of Fame inductees.
